[0001] This utility model relates to the field of cooling molding technology, and in particular to a cooling device for continuous extrusion molding of PE pipes. Background Technology
[0002] PE pipes, or polyethylene pipes, are characterized by their excellent corrosion resistance, effectively resisting the erosion of various chemicals. They also possess good flexibility, facilitating installation and laying. They are widely used in water supply and drainage systems and gas transmission. However, their production requires continuous extrusion molding. Polyethylene raw materials are added to the hopper of an extruder. Inside the extruder is a screw, driven by a motor, which rotates and generates forward thrust on the raw material. During this process, the raw material passes through a heating device, gradually increasing its temperature and causing the PE material to gradually transform from a solid state to a viscous flow state. When a suitable plasticizing state is reached, the molten PE material passes through a specific die. The shape of the die determines the outer and inner diameter of the pipe. After extrusion, the pipe is initially formed, but it is still relatively soft and requires a cooling device, typically using air or water cooling, to rapidly cool and solidify the pipe, thus maintaining its shape. Then, a traction device pulls the pipe out at a set speed, allowing for continuous extrusion molding of PE pipes and a continuous production of pipes. The cooling mechanism is particularly important in this molding process.
[0003] The cooling mechanism for continuous extrusion molding of PE pipes mainly consists of a cooling water tank and a cooling fan. It comprises a fan, a water tank, and a stationary block. The cooling water tank is the most common cooling component; it is typically a long, narrow trough. The pipe enters the tank directly after being extruded from the die. The tank is filled with cooling water, which is usually kept at a relatively low temperature. As the hot PE pipe passes through the tank, heat is transferred to the cooling water through heat conduction, rapidly cooling the pipe. The cooling fan comes into play after the pipe leaves the water tank, further cooling the pipe primarily through airflow. Cold air is blown onto the surface of the pipe, carrying away the heat and accelerating the cooling speed. At the same time, the position of the cooling mechanism and its coordination with the extruder are precisely designed to ensure that the pipe can enter the cooling stage in time while it is still soft after extrusion, and that the cooling speed can match the extrusion speed of the pipe, so that the pipe can be cooled evenly during continuous extrusion. This prevents the pipe from deforming or internal stress concentration due to excessive local temperature differences. However, this type of cooling mechanism can only be replaced for water pipes of one inner diameter and cannot be adapted to water pipes of different inner diameters, resulting in low cooling efficiency. [0039] Working principle: When cooling is required, the water pipe is first placed inside the cooling shell 13. Then, the water pipe is pressed against the surface of the ring 8 by the conical head 10, and then pressed against the surface of the cooling inner cylinder 11 by the ring 8. At this time, the cooling inner cylinder 11 will compress the spring 7 according to the internal shape of the water pipe. At the same time, the cooling inner cylinder 11 will compress the sliding rod 6, so that the sliding rod 6 moves along the inside of the circular hole 5 of the connecting rod 4 until the cooling inner cylinder 11 is in contact with the inner wall of the water pipe. At this time, the outer wall of the water pipe is in contact with the inner wall of the cooling shell 13, which can perform cooling treatment. This achieves the function of cooling water pipes of different sizes.
[0040] When cooling is required, heat is transferred through the cooling inner cylinder 11 to the connecting bridge 201, and then through the connecting bridge 201 to the heat sink 202. The fan 203 is then activated, drawing in cool air through the air intake hole 16 on the air intake fin 15. The air then passes through the second heat dissipation hole 206 on the heat sink 202 to cool it down. The cooled hot air is then exhausted through the first heat dissipation hole 205 on the heat sink shell 204, thus achieving the effect of cooling the water pipe by cooling the heat sink 202.
